diff --git a/components/script/dom/countqueuingstrategy.rs b/components/script/dom/countqueuingstrategy.rs index bbc0ff15b7a..6e6eef9f357 100644 --- a/components/script/dom/countqueuingstrategy.rs +++ b/components/script/dom/countqueuingstrategy.rs @@ -61,7 +61,7 @@ impl CountQueuingStrategyMethods for CountQueuingStrategy } /// - fn GetSize(&self) -> Fallible> { + fn GetSize(&self, _can_gc: CanGc) -> Fallible> { let global = self.global(); // Return this's relevant global object's count queuing strategy // size function. diff --git a/components/script_bindings/codegen/Bindings.conf b/components/script_bindings/codegen/Bindings.conf index f5e61114a4b..e0e00968e20 100644 --- a/components/script_bindings/codegen/Bindings.conf +++ b/components/script_bindings/codegen/Bindings.conf @@ -82,6 +82,10 @@ DOMInterfaces = { 'canGc': ['Before', 'After', 'ReplaceWith'] }, +'CountQueuingStrategy': { + 'canGc': ['GetSize'], +}, + 'CSSStyleDeclaration': { 'canGc': ['RemoveProperty', 'SetCssText', 'GetPropertyValue', 'SetProperty', 'CssFloat', 'SetCssFloat'] },